    A Public Right Area Object representing the spatial extent of a protected landscape as a result of the public interest or common good. These areas can include habitat, wilderness areas and other special management areas. This cadastral framework provides a parcel base of properly structured vector data designed and suited for Geographical Information System (GIS) application and can be used for land management purposes. This data set is not be used for defining boundaries. Administrative decisions should be based on legal documents and legal survey plans. Distributed from GeoYukon by the Government of Yukon .     Surveyed Easement Boundaries consists of the lines required to form the boundaries of the Easements. COGO attributes are associated to the lines and depict the adjusted framework of the easement fabric. Distributed from GeoYukon by the Government of Yukon .     Surveyed Land Parcel Boundaries consist of the lines required to form the boundaries of the Land Parcels. COGO attributes are associated to the lines and depict the adjusted framework of the cadastral fabric. Distributed from GeoYukon by the Government of Yukon .
